Jaydees Naturals Partners with Dr. Asha Martin to Provide Safe, Restorative Hair & Skin Care for Cancer Patients in St Lucia
In a timely collaboration rooted in care and wellness, Jaydees Naturals has partnered with Dominican-born Dr. Asha Martin, a hematologist and oncologist in St. Lucia, to curate a special line of clean and clear hair skin products and other personal care products for cancer patients. Mrs Dangleben, the owner and founder of Jaydees Naturals launched this collaboration as part of the “Caribbean Business Cruise” organized by Isanaja Consulting, in collaboration with the OECS Commission.

The UWI Five Islands Public Advocacy Series looks at Artificial Intelligence for Economic Development
Following several recent advancements in the world of Artificial Intelligence, The University of the West Indies (UWI) Five Islands Campus will host a virtual public advocacy forum, “AI for the Economic Development of Emerging Economies,” on Monday, Feb. 24, 2025, at 6:30 p.m. AST. The event will explore how artificial intelligence can drive innovation and growth in developing economies across the Caribbean, Latin America, Africa, Asia and beyond.
PRIME MINISTER ROOSEVELT SKERRIT ATTENDS 48th HEADS OF GOVERNMENT MEETING IN BARBADOS
Roseau Dominica-February 19, 2025: Prime Minister Hon. Roosevelt Skerrit will participate in the 48th Regular Meeting of the CARICOM Heads of Government, scheduled to take place in Bridgetown, Barbados from February 19 to 21, 2025.
